Likewise, how do you write a compliance program?
Elements an Effective Compliance Program
- Establish and adopt written policies, procedures, and standards of conduct.
- Create program oversight.
- Provide staff training and education.
- Establish two-way communication at all levels.
- Implement a monitoring and auditing system.
- Enforce consistent discipline.
Why is compliance so important?
Enforcing compliance helps your company prevent and detect violations of rules, which protects your organization from fines and lawsuits. The compliance process should be ongoing. Many organizations establish a program to consistently and accurately govern their compliance policies over time.
